Understanding Trust Administration

Trust administration is the process of managing and distributing assets held in a trust according to its terms and applicable law.

This includes asset collection, notifying beneficiaries, filing tax returns, and ensuring distributions align with the settlor’s instructions.

Definition and Explanation

A trust is a legal arrangement where the grantor places assets under the management of a trustee for the benefit of designated beneficiaries.

Key Elements and Processes

Common steps include identifying the trust and assets, inventorying property, locating documents, communicating with beneficiaries, and administering distributions in a timely, compliant manner.

Key Terms and Glossary

Key terms to understand when navigating trust administration.

Trust

A trust is a legal arrangement that places assets under the control of a trustee for the benefit of one or more beneficiaries.

Trustee

The person or institution entrusted with managing the trust assets and carrying out its terms.

Beneficiary

A person or organization entitled to receive benefits from the trust.

Fiduciary

A fiduciary is someone who must act in the best interests of the trust and its beneficiaries, with honesty and good faith.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is trust administration?

Trust administration involves managing assets in a trust according to its terms and applicable law. This includes inventory, notifying beneficiaries, filing tax returns, and distributing assets as directed by the trust.

The trustee is typically responsible for administering the trust, ensuring duties are carried out, and acting in the best interests of the beneficiaries. If there are questions or disputes, engaging a trusted attorney can help clarify duties and options.

Costs vary based on the complexity of the trust, the estate, and required filings. A transparent plan will outline anticipated fees and timelines up front.

Timeframes depend on asset complexity, creditor claims, and court involvement. Many straightforward trusts conclude administration within months; more complex matters may take longer.

Disputes can be addressed through clear documentation and, if needed, mediation. A well-drafted plan provides paths to resolve issues while protecting beneficiaries’ interests.

Certain trusts can be amended or restated if allowed by the trust provisions and applicable law. A careful review with counsel helps determine feasible options.

A trust can avoid probate for assets held within it, but some assets or circumstances may still require probate intervention. Consulting with a trust administrator helps clarify the specific situation.

Gather the trust document, asset lists, deeds, financial statements, tax records, and contact information for beneficiaries. Having organized records speeds up the process and reduces uncertainty.

A periodic review, at least annually, is recommended to ensure the trust aligns with laws and family needs. Updates may be needed after major life events or changes in law.
